The Star News staff is comprised of Publisher/Editor Carol O’Leary along with her daughter, General Manager Kris O’Leary and a staff of 17 employees. Publisher/Editor - Carol O'Leary

Carol has been in the newspaper business since 1964. She and her late husband J.A. O'Leary purchased The Star News and The Shopper in 1986. She is also the publisher of The Tribune-Phonograph, Record Review and Central Wisconsin Shopper, located in Abbotsford. She enjoys international travel and making costumes for the Abbotsford Christmas Parade. She serves on the boards of the Wisconsin Newspaper Association Foundation and the International Society of Weekly Newspaper Editors and is a past member of the board of Inland Press Association Foundation.

General Manager - Kristine O'Leary

Kris O'Leary grew up in Abbotsford and received her BSW from the UW-Eau Claire. She worked for Taylor County for 5 years and started work as General Manager of The Star News in May of 1997. The family newspaper has always been a part of her life and she is proud to carry on the tradition into the next generation. Kris is active in the Wisconsin Newspaper Association, the Inland Press Association, and the International Society of Weekly Newspaper Editors. Locally, she is also involved in the Medford Chamber of Commerce, Kiwanis, the Abbotsford Chamber, and the Abbotsford Christmas Parade. Kris enjoys reading, spending time with her husband and children, and walking her dog.

News Editor - Brian Wilson

Brian Wilson earned a journalism degree from Northwestern University’s Medill School of Journalism in 1995. He came to work at The Star News in May 1996. Initially he covered sports until moving over to the news side in 1999 when he became Associate Editor. He primarily covers municipal government. Outside of work, Wilson enjoys curling, reading science fiction, and spending time with his family.

Sports Editor - Matt Frey

Matt came to The Star News in May 1998 after three and a half years at the Lakeland Times in Minocqua. Frey has won WNA first-place awards at both newspapers. He is a 1994 graduate of UW-River Falls, where he majored in journalism. He is a 1990 graduate of Medford Area Senior High. He enjoys deer hunting, intensely watching football, playing basketball and dreaming of the day the Brewers make the playoffs.

Sales Consultant - Bailey Jari

After serving in the Marines for four years, Bailey Jari has returned to The Star News in the position of sales consultant. Jari, worked in the graphic design department of The Star News through the school to work program in high school and after graduation in 2003, until she joined the service in September 2003.
During her four years in the Marines, Jari worked as a Field Wireman earning the rank of sergeant. As part of her job, she set up telecommunication networks and served in California and Japan. She was discharged in September 2007 and came back to Medford to be closer to her family and to raise her two children Jordan and Ava. In addition to spending time with her family, Jari enjoys hunting and being outdoors.
